The Pressure’s On: What’s Too Much?

Imagine a patient presenting with a sustained IAP of 23 mmHg. That’s what we call intra-abdominal hypertension (IAH), and let me tell you, it can turn your day—pretty much everyone’s day—upside down. IAP in this range is not just a number; it signals a potential risk of developing abdominal compartment syndrome, a condition that can jeopardize vital organ function. Can you picture it? Elevated pressures squeezing organs, impairing blood flow, and leading to a whole host of complications.

Now, the question arises: What’s the best response? The options zoom in on four key treatment modalities: abdominal decompression, fluid resuscitation, antibiotic therapy, and nutritional support. But hold on, let’s shine a light on why abdominal decompression (A) takes the lead here.

Abdominal Decompression: The Top Pick

When the numbers climb to 23 mmHg, your immediate concern should be on intervention that alleviates that pressure. Abdominal decompression is hands down the most effective approach for addressing high IAP—think of it as releasing the steam from a pressure cooker. This intervention can include surgical procedures or less invasive methods, depending on the severity and the patient’s condition.

What really matters? It’s about alleviating that pressure in the abdominal cavity to restore normal organ perfusion and function. It’s a bit like getting the air out of an over-inflated tire—not only does it relieve pressure, but it also allows the vehicle to function properly. Similarly, decompression lets the organs “breathe” a sigh of relief, ensuring there's no long-term damage due to compromised blood flow.

Other Strategies: Important, but Not Immediate

Now, don't get me wrong—fluid resuscitation (B), antibiotic therapy (C), and nutritional support (D) are all vital when managing critical patients. They can be lifesavers in certain situations but are not the first port of call for elevated IAP.

Fluid Resuscitation: Sure, if our patient is in hypovolemic shock, increasing fluid levels is a must. But let’s face it: pouring more fluid into an already pressurized system isn't going to fix the root of the problem—it could actually make it worse!

Antibiotic Therapy: While antibiotics play a critical role in combating infection, they won’t do anything to lower that pesky intra-abdominal pressure. If the patient has an underlying infection, antibiotics are absolutely vital, but here, they are more about addressing secondary complications rather than the immediate need.

Nutritional Support: This is crucial for recovery, especially in critically ill patients. And, you can bet your bottom dollar that a well-nourished body has a better shot at recovery. But in the thick of it, worrying about nutritional support while IAP levels are cresting is like trying to refuel a taxi while the engine’s overheating—let’s cool it down first!

So really, while those other strategies are undeniably important pieces of the overall critical care puzzle, they do not directly tackle the elephant in the room: elevated IAP.
